Zoysia grass cultivation methods and precautions

Zoysia grass cultivation methods and precautions

1. Maintenance methods

1. Water: Zoysia grass does not have strict requirements for water, and watering it twice a day is sufficient. In spring and summer, you need to water it more often. In autumn, you only need to water it once a day.

2. Soil: It can grow in most lands, but the soil is best if it is fertile, loose and rich in organic matter. When using soil, keep it clean and sterile, and disinfect it after mixing.

3. Temperature: It likes to grow in a mild climate and grows fastest in an environment of 13-25℃, and the plant will grow better. The temperature in winter should not be lower than minus 20℃.

4. Light: It is not very strict about light requirements. Try to let it get more sun. It is best to have relatively good lighting conditions. In order to ensure its healthy growth, it should be given sufficient light and not kept in a dark place.

2. Breeding techniques

1. Sowing: It can be done in April-May in spring, or in August-September in autumn. First, prepare the land, apply base fertilizer, and spray some suitable herbicides. After sowing the seeds, cover them with three centimeters of fine soil to keep them warm and moisturizing.

2. Pruning: Because it grows too fast and too lush, it needs to be pruned regularly. Generally, it only needs to be pruned once every thirty days or so, and once when winter comes.

3. Problem diagnosis and treatment

1. Leaf blight: After being infected with leaf blight, small spots will appear on the leaves and leaf tips, and the leaves will become dry. The affected area must be cleaned with medicine. It can be sprayed with thiophanate-methyl and disinfected.

2. Rust: After the disease occurs, there will be slightly raised spots on the leaves, which will turn yellow, and the leaves will dry and curl. Methyl thiophanate should be used for spraying and control, or Baume lime sulfur mixture can also be used.

IV. Other issues

1. Can it be grown outdoors: It can be grown outdoors, can be made into a sports field, or can be used as a lawn. It has good elasticity and is very practical.

2. Is it edible? It has no nutritional value, so it is not recommended to be eaten. The cultivation is generally for appreciation or for greening purposes.
